Advantage Resourcing are currently looking for a design engineer for a global defence organisation based in Scotstoun for a global defence organisation. This is a 6 month contract paying £35.00 per hour LTD.

The job will be working on some of the most bespoke and advanced naval warships in the country and they are looking for someone to come in and review design maturity for the ships. The role will be fast paced and will expose you to new technology helping you gain news skills for future employment.

We are looking for people who have the following skills:

  • Engineering knowledge to develop maintain and evolve processes and guidance to control, manage and measure engineering artefact maturity.
  • Managing the Engineering Technical Maturity, through coordinating Zonal Reviews and designating/implementing Maturity Targets relating to transition gates.
  • Management of Engineering Quality Issues and Stakeholder Observations relating to Compartment Plan Approvals
  • Windchill Document and Process Management
  • Interacting with all stakeholders in assigned areas on engineering matters, to resolve relatively complex problems and issues and manage scope and priorities
  • Organised and self-motivated, capable of providing accurate information in a timely manner.
  • Experience of communicating engineering issues and providing specifications for toolset developments, including communications, training and support of deployed toolsets and reports.
  • STEM Degree, working towards a degree or equivalent qualification, or level of experience working within an engineering discipline

Desirable skills will include:

  • LCM Governance, practical experience of Design or phase Reviews, knowledge of Maturity Management.
  • T26 GCS Engineering Processes, Toolsets and project reporting toolsets
  • Experience producing Excel Spreadsheets and graphical representation of data.
  • Ability to produce Technical Information providing supporting evidence of assurance to all stakeholders
  • Experience of Process Confirmations or Audit activities.
  • Stakeholder Management and excellent communication skills
  • Professional Registration, working toward Incorporated or Chartered Engineer.
